Poultry vaccinated against Ranikhet at Thipuzumi

Phek, January 29 (MExN): An animal health cum vaccination camp was held at Thipuzumi village in Kikruma block under the project National Initiative on Climate Resilient Agriculture (NICRA), CRIDA, Hyderabad on January 25. Organized by Krishi Vigyan Kendra Phek, the camp was conducted by Dr. Debojyoti Borkotoky, Subject Matter Specialist (Animal Science) assisted by Potsulu Theluo, Senior Research Fellow, NICRA project and staff Arovi.  

More than 700 poultry birds were vaccinated against Ranikhet disease, a press release informed. Ranikhet is a highly contagious disease in fowls causing great economic loss to farmers every year due to its endemic and epidemic nature. Veterinary counseling and treatment to the ailing animals were provided to the livestock farmers of the village during the camp. Anthelmentic medicines and mineral mixture for chicken, turkey, pig, thotho, dog and cat were also made available. Meanwhile, animal health promoting supplements and medicines were provided to boost the immunity of their animals against various livestock diseases which may arise in case of climate stress.  

The members of Village Climate Risk Management Committee (VCRMC) of the project assisted in motivating and mobilizing the farmers and youth of the village to participate in the camp.
